Senior Director of Global Network Infrastructure Jones Lang LaSalle (JLL) Position Overview Jones Lang LaSalle, a leading international commercial real estate firm, is seeking an exceptional Senior Director of Global Network Infrastructure to lead our enterprise-wide network strategy and operations. This executive role encompasses responsibility for global network architecture, cloud and on-premises infrastructure, network security operations, and operational excellence across all JLL locations worldwide. Reporting directly to the Global Head of Infrastructure Operations, this position provides strategic leadership for network infrastructure services that enable JLL's global business operations. Required Qualifications

Education & Experience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Information Technology, or related field required; Master's degree strongly preferred 15+ years of progressive IT infrastructure experience with at least 10 years in network architecture and operations 8+ years in senior leadership roles managing large global teams and complex network environments 5+ years of executive-level experience with C-suite interaction and board-level presentations Proven track record leading enterprise-wide network transformation initiatives Technical Expertise Deep expertise in enterprise network architecture: routing protocols (BGP, OSPF), switching (802.1Q, VPC, MC-LAG), data center fabrics (Spine-Leaf, VXLAN) Extensive knowledge of cloud networking across AWS (VPC, Transit Gateway, Direct Connect), Azure (VNet, ExpressRoute, Virtual WAN), and GCP Strong understanding of SD-WAN technologies, overlay networks, and application-aware routing Comprehensive knowledge of network security: firewalls, IPS/IDS, network segmentation, zero-trust architecture Experience with network automation and infrastructure-as-code (Terraform, Ansible, Python) Familiarity with observability platforms (Datadog, ThousandEyes, CloudWatch) and ITSM frameworks (ITIL) Leadership Competencies Strategic thinking with ability to translate business needs into technical solutions Exceptional communication skills with ability to influence at all organizational levels Strong financial acumen and budget management experience Proven change management capabilities in complex global organizations Executive presence and credibility with senior stakeholders Cross-cultural awareness and experience leading geographically distributed teams Business Acumen Understanding of commercial real estate industry and business drivers (preferred) Experience managing P&L responsibility and optimizing infrastructure TCO Ability to build compelling business cases linking technology investments to business outcomes Track record of successful vendor negotiations and contract management Risk management perspective balanced with innovation and transformation Why Join JLL?
